Russian scientists have created a promising coating for airliners

Russia has developed a special coating for composites Scientists from Perm NIPU have announced the development of a new protective coating with shock-resistant properties, designed to be applied to aircraft parts based on composite materials.

The development is characterized by a thin protective layer with a low mass, capable of withstanding temperatures in the range from -60 ° C to a fairly serious 250 ° C.

As is known, polycomposites are used in the manufacture of a number of parts in the aircraft industry, but these materials do not resist high—speed shock loads (for example, a collision with a flying bird), and the promising development of Perm scientists should solve this problem. The basis of the proposed special coating is ammonia derivatives, as well as isocyanate, on the basis of which polyurethane is produced. The thickness of the developed coating does not exceed 0.3 mm and its application to the surface of aircraft elements will not lead to a cardinal weighting of the entire structure.

Russia has developed a special coating for composites In addition, the first coating tests have already been carried out on the bodies of aircraft engines made of composites, which showed an increase in the ballistic limit of the structure by 18.5%, while the mass increased by a fairly acceptable 6.5%. According to the Perm NIPU, the new development can be used not only in aviation — it is suitable for use in other directions — with this coating it will be possible to process windshields and car bodies, hulls of motor boats and small boats, etc.
